CM: Leao hits the ground running in preseason – Milan’s renewal plan as Chelsea show interest

Rafael Leao was one of the key driving forces as AC Milan ended their Scudetto drought but now the club must ensure that he is around for many years to come.

Calciomercato.com write how Leao was among the positive notes in the 5-0 victory against Wolfsberger to end the preseason retreat in Austria as he scored the first goal and showed himself to be in excellent condition for the 45 minutes he played, along with Theo Hernandez on the left.

Some interest has arrived from abroad in Leao – especially from Chelsea – and in the meantime talks over the renewal of the winger have not yet taken off and do not seem destined to do so in the short term.

Leao has yet to close the legal issue with Sporting CP regarding the compensation payment from terminating his contract, which is one factor, but also Milan have other priorities right now with Maldini and Massara focused on the De Ketelaere front.

His contract extension will still be addressed again in the coming weeks, perhaps with the market closed, because even RedBird and Gerry Cardinale – who will lead Milan into a new era – know that Leao is a precious resource.
